Sierra:
Good morning.  We're in need of several portable multimeters with the following capabilities:

Will see DC use only
Max/Min and AVERAGE
mA and uA measuring
External datalogging (ideally without too much expense)

We have a single Fluke 289 now which is good but too expensive to be buying in multiples and the additional expense for data logging is high.

Have many many Uni-T UT61C meters that have served us well but are lacking the AVERAGE feature which is a big deal for our use.

mwb1100:
Brymen BM827s, BM829s, BM867s, or BM869s

Uni-T UT171A

EEVBlog 121GW


It might be a bit dated, but the table compiled at https://lygte-info.dk/info/DMMReviews.html will net you about dozen more possibilities.
